Mumbai college throws 50 students with ATKT out of hostel

For a week, the students of Government Polytechnic in Kherwadi area were forced to spend nights at bus stops and railway stations

A bizarre rule introduced by the administration of the Government Polytechnic in Kherwadi area a week back has left about 50 students homeless. Since the authorities decided to discontinue hostel facilities for those who have even a single paper left to be cleared, the students have been sleeping at bus stops and railway stations. Due to the poor financial condition of their families, they can't even afford accommodation in the city.

They met Joint Director of Technical Education, Pramod Naik, a few days ago
